Guest Chris Smith Posted September 14, 2016 Posted September 14, 2016 http://androidforum.us/data/MetaMirrorCache/7afe0b730f51c9f15df3c2378d707f4e.jpgThe Galaxy Note 7 recall soap opera is far from over, as Samsung still has a lot of work to do to deal with this mess and clear its name. Reports on Tuesday said that Samsung is looking to limit the maximum battery charge of the phone’s battery to 60%, to diminish explosion risks. But it appears that Samsung won’t just kill battery life on all Galaxy Note 7 units just yet.
